Is 90 902 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 90 902 is about 301.500.

Thus, the square root of 90 902 is not an integer, and therefore 90 902 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 90 902?

The square of a number (here 90 902) is the result of the product of this number (90 902) by itself (i.e., 90 902 × 90 902); the square of 90 902 is sometimes called "raising 90 902 to the power 2", or "90 902 squared".

The square of 90 902 is 8 263 173 604 because 90 902 × 90 902 = 90 9022 = 8 263 173 604.

As a consequence, 90 902 is the square root of 8 263 173 604.
